Tuna Macaroni Salad
  1. In a large bowl, whisk together all of the brine ingredients and set aside.

  2. Bring a large pot of salted water to boil and cook elbow macaroni to al dente. Drain and run the macaroni under cold water to cool it off and stop the cooking process.

  3. Whisk the brine again then add the elbow macaroni, drained tuna, hard-boiled eggs, onion, peas, and pickles. Mix well to coat. At this time it is best to refrigerate overnight so that the flavors absorb.

  4. The next day, add the mayo and mix well again. Add more mayo as required to get a creamy consistency. Taste test and season with salt and pepper to taste. Enjoy!
